CEDAR FALLS, Iowa--The University of Northern Iowa women's soccer team looks to defend their perfect mark on the season as they host South Dakota State and Montana this weekend.
The Jackrabbits (2-3-1) of South Dakota State come to town for a 7 p.m. match up on Sept. 8. South Dakota State leads the all-time series with Northern Iowa, 7-1-3, with wins in the last two match ups. The Panthers won the last match up in Cedar Falls, 2-1, in 2014 but the Jacks hold a 3-1-1 advantage in road games against UNI in the series. In their last two matches, South Dakota State tied Iowa State before winning in overtime against Creighton, 3-2. Between the posts, Maggie Smither has recorded 26 saves on the season.
The Grizzlies (4-2-0) of Montana come to town on Sept. 10 for a 12 p.m. match up. It will be the first meeting between the two teams. Montana is led by a pair of freshmen, Alexa Coyle and Claire Howard. Coyle leads the team, with three goals, six points and eight shots on goal. Howard has posted two shutouts in the goal.
For the Panthers, junior Jami Reichenberger has yet to allow a goal this season, outscoring UNI's opponents 11-0. Reichenberger has started in all five games for the Panthers. Reichenberger, is ranked No. 2 in shutouts for the season in the nation, behind UW-Milwaukee who has played one more game. Senior Sarah Brandt, who sits tied at third for all-time UNI career goals, and Brynell Yount are leading the Panther attack through five games, tallying eight points (three goals, two assists) apiece while Hannah McDevitt has a goal and an assist.

Regional Rankings
Two MVC teams are in The United Soccer Coaches' Midwest Regional Ranking. Northern Iowa lands at No. 12 in the rankings. Valparaiso, making the list for the third-straight week, fell to No. 15.
UNI on the Leaderboard
UNI remains undefeated after 5 games. The Panthers are one of 14 teams with a 1.000 win-loss percentage. Junior goalkeeper, Jami Reichenberger, is ranked No. 2 in shutouts for the season, behind UW-Milwaukee who has played one more game.
Undefeated at Home
Northern Iowa along with conferences opponents, Valparaiso, Drake, and Indiana State have not lost a game at home this season.
